  1. Butter Chicken: Butter Chicken, otherwise called Murgh Makhani, is an exemplary North Indian curry that has caught the hearts and palates of individuals all over the planet. This rich and creamy dish highlights delicious bits of marinated chicken cooked in a tomato-based sauce, imbued with butter, cream and a mix of fragrant spices. Presented with naan bread or rice, Butter Chicken is a genuine extravagance for curry lovers.
  2. Rogan Josh: Starting from the Kashmiri cooking, Rogan Josh is an energetic and fragrant curry that exhibits the locale’s culinary legacy. This lamb-based curry is known for its signature red tone and hearty flavors. The delicate bits of meat are stewed in a mix of Kashmiri chili, ginger, garlic, and a mix of spices that make a tempting mix of flavors. Rogan Josh is best enjoyed with steamed rice or conventional Indian bread like roti or paratha.
  3. Chana Masala: Vegan and vegetarian curry darlings celebrate, for Chana Masala is here to please your taste buds. Produced using chickpeas (chana) cooked in a delightful tomato and onion-based sauce, this curry is a staple in North Indian food. The blend of fragrant spices and tart flavors makes Chana Masala a hearty and fulfilling dish that matches well with rice or naan bread.
  4. Saag Paneer: Saag Paneer is a cherished vegan curry that highlights paneer, a firm Indian curd, cooked in a rich and creamy spinach-based sauce. The paneer cubes retain the kinds of the fragrant spices and the creamy surface of the sauce, bringing about a delicious dish. Saag Paneer is best enjoyed with soft basmati rice or newly baked naan bread.

Distinctive Features of Indian Restaurants

  1. Fine Dining:

    Wonderful Gastronomic Excursions Fine dining establishments in India are known for their sumptuous feel, perfect service, and best-created menus. These restaurants exhibit the epitome of culinary artistry, consolidating conventional Indian flavors with contemporary strategies. Whether it’s the special kinds of Awadhi cuisine or the dynamic spices of South India, fine dining restaurants offer a genuinely vivid gastronomic experience.

  2. Street Food Hubs:

    Investigating the Energetic Chaat Culture India’s street food culture is a culinary experience in itself. From clamoring chaat slows down to sizzling oven barbecues, these street food hubs are a dining experience for the faculties. Enjoy delectable joys like fresh golgappas, appetizing pav bhaji, and sweet-smelling kebabs, all pre-arranged just before your eyes. These vivacious and dynamic spaces unite the pith of Indian street food, offering a magnificent fusion of flavors.

  3. Regional Cuisine:

    A Gastronomic Excursion Across India’s huge and different scene leads to a large number of regional cuisines, each with its particular flavors and culinary practices. Whether it’s the spicy curries of Punjab, the seafood indulgences of Kerala, or the vegetarian joys of Gujarat, regional cuisine restaurants take you on a gastronomic excursion the nation over. Submerge yourself in the valid kinds of a specific district and experience the social extravagance through its cuisine.

  4. Vegetarian Restaurants:

    Praising the Pith of Plant-Based Joys India has a well-established custom of vegetarianism, and vegetarian restaurants feature the staggering assortment and development of plant-based cuisine. These restaurants take care of the developing interest in vegetarian and veggie lovers’ choices, offering a wide cluster of dishes that are both nutritious and tasty. From generous thalis to inventive plant-based manifestations, vegetarian restaurants praise the embodiment of vegetarian delights.

  5. Fusion and Contemporary Cuisine:

    Where Custom Meets Development The fusion and contemporary cuisine scene in India is a demonstration of the imaginative mixing of conventional flavors with current culinary procedures. These restaurants push the limits of gastronomy, offering unique and imaginative dishes that are an agreeable mix of Indian and global impacts. Investigate the culinary masterfulness of prestigious cooks who rethink customary recipes and make invigorating new flavor profiles.
